Need for Speed: Shift 2 Unleashed, released in 2011, revives the thrill of racing with an immersive experience that showcases the intensity of being behind the wheel. This racing title emphasizes realism, offering players a dynamic driving simulation that combines excitement with skillful control, making it a notable entry in the franchise. With its engaging gameplay and realistic graphics, Shift 2 Unleashed invites players to push their limits on various tracks and vehicles.
